Description

To fell 5 no Cypress trees in rear garden of Westfield Cottage. The trees are causing serious shading issues to Westfield Cottage & other neighbouring properties. Also, causing serious issues with blocked gutters & drainpipes in the immediate adjacent properties, namely: The Smithy, The Workshops & The Blacksmiths. All owners have requested trees to be felled. The 5 no Cypress trees will be felled by a qualified arborist - Ecotrees of Sheffield. The Cypress trees are of low amenity value, are non-native and wholly inappropriate in a conservation area in the town of Bakewell, in the heart of the Peak District National Park. Once felled, the trees will be replaced with a native species hedgerow which will be maintained to a heigh of circa 2 metres once established. This will be of greater ecological benefit.
